c# switch case nedir - Genel Bakış

Anahtar her çaldatmaıştırıldığında test ifadesinin kıymeti, anahtarın içre teşhismladığımız tüm durumlarla karşılaştırılır. Test ifadesinin 4 kıymetini derunerdiğini varsayalım.

şayet break komutu kullanılmazsa, bir ahir case bloğu da çallıkıştırılır ki bu alelumum istenmeyen bir durumdur.

Незадължителният случай по подразбиране се изпълнява, когато няма други съвпадения.

Стойността, предоставена от потребителя, се сравнява с всички случаи в блока за превключване, докато се намери съвпадението.

. That is an additional condition that must be satisfied together with a matched pattern. A case guard must be a Boolean expression. You specify a case guard after the when keyword that follows a pattern, bey the following example shows:

Switch case yapkaloriın en anayasa özelliklerinden biri, break ifadesinin kullanılmasıdır. Her bir case bloğu sonunda kesinlikle bir break ifadesi arazi almalıdır. Damarlı takdirde, yetişek bir ahir case bloğuna geçebilir ve istenmeyen sonuçlar doğurabilir.

Yukarıdaki örnekte, program A, B yahut C harflerinden birisini girmenizi lüzum. Izlence girdiğiniz harfi cd bileğhizmetkenine atar. Sonrasında, harfi kaç kez görüntülük yazdırmak istediğinizi belirlemek için 1, 3 yahut 5 sayılarından birini girmenizi lüzum ve girdiğiniz kıymeti id bileğçalışmakenine atar. switch lafıbında id oynak kıymeti kadar girdiğiniz harfi ekrana yazar.

Switch case bünyesında break komutunun yararlanmaı son nokta önemlidir. Her bir case bloğunun ahir break komutu nokta almazsa, harf bir ahir case bloğuna da geçiş yapabilir.

Try it Each case must exit the case explicitly by using break, return, goto statement, or some other way, making sure the izlence control exits a case and cannot fall through to the default case.

Bu perese umumiyetle istenmeyen bir sonuç doğurur ve kodun hatalı çallıkışmasına illet evet. Break komutu, case blokları arasında yararsız intikallerin önlenmesini sağlar ve switch ifadesinin gerçek bir şekilde sonlanmasını garanti paha.

400 TL den şu denli olan alışverişler karınin %20 Buna göre bir kişinin ödeyeceği kupkuru rakamı hesaplayan C# yetişekın kodunu yazınız.(C# Dürüstış denetçi mekanizmaları önlaştırma operatörleri

Bu konstrüksiyonnın yararı, kodu daha okunabilir, derneşik ve performanslı hale getirmesidir. Switch case kullanarak, if-else bloklarının münasebet başüstüneğu karmaşıklığı azaltabilir ve kodunuzu daha harbi bir gestaltda örgütlü edebilirsiniz.

The continue statement in C is a jump statement that is used to bring the izlence control to the start of the loop. We kişi use the continue statement in the while loop, for c# switch case örnek loop, or do.

ile ilgili potansiyel bir sıkıntı var if-else ifadesi iletişim hangisiplexAlternatif sistem skorsı arttıkça programın niteliği bile artar.

Leave a Reply

Your email address will not be published. Required fields are marked *